Double Glazed Window Repairs

Over time double glazing can develop problems such as mist between glass or rotting frame. These issues are simple to fix and can be less expensive than you thought.

There may be an insurance policy for your double glazing, check with the company you bought it from. It is also recommended to solve any issues you encounter yourself.

Sealing

Window seals (also called upvc window repairs near me seals) play a crucial role in the insulation and double-glazed windows. Incorrect seals can cause drafts, condensation and other issues. Fortunately, damaged seals can be replaced or repaired to restore the efficiency of your double glazing.

The most common sign that your double glazed windows require sealing is water leakage between the glass panes. This moisture can cause stains, damage the window frames, and increase the cost of energy. The condensation between glass can cause a foggy look that can come and go depending upon indoor/outdoor temperature or humidity levels.

If you believe that the seals on your double-glazed windows are faulty, it's recommended to contact the installer. They will visit your home and reseal damaged areas, which is usually less expensive than replacing the entire window unit. Also, you should look over your warranty documents as the company who installed your double-glazed windows could still be under warranty, saving you money on the cost of repairs or replacements.

A double-glazed window repair technician will use different tools to repair your broken windows, including gasket rollers that assist in helping to push the new seals into the right position. These tools will also help you get an air-tight seal that is essential for windows' efficiency.

When the seal between a double-glazed window's glass panes is damaged, it can lead to a number of issues, including moisture between the panes, an inefficiency of energy and a misaligned view. A window seal replacement typically involves removing the glass and replacing it with a fresh one, that can be accomplished in most cases without having to replace the entire frame of the window.

Glass

Double glazed windows have two glass panes, with an air space between. The air is filled with gases such as Krypton and argon that reduce the heat transfer through your windows. This allows you to keep your home at a pleasant temperature without putting too much strain on your cooling and heating system. If one of your double-glazed windows becomes broken or cracked, you'll want to repair it swiftly.

Replacing the glass of your double-glazed window is usually the best solution. It's important to realize that fixing double-paned windows entails more than simply replacing the glass. It also involves replacing the factory seal that allows your window to perform just as it should. Double glazing can last for many years when maintained properly, but there are problems that do arise. These issues can affect the efficiency of double-glazed doors and windows and make them appear unsightly. There are several solutions to address these issues at a reasonable price. It is not necessary to replace your windows.

A common issue that double-glazed windows suffer from is misting. This happens when the seal around the glass panel fails allowing moisture-laden air enter between the panes of glass. This could cause the glass to become hazy or wet. It can also reduce the insulation capacity of double-glazed windows.

This type of problem is extremely frustrating since it can seriously affect the look and efficiency of your double glazed windows. One of the most frequent problems reported by double glazing owners is that their doors and windows are difficult to open or close. This could be due to a number factors, such as extreme temperatures or the accumulation of dirt. This issue can be repaired by a double-glazing repair service.

Another common issue is misting between the glass panes. Misting is normally caused by problems with the seals. Double glazing repairs can fix these issues, but in some cases they need to be completely replaced. This will lessen condensation and prevent draughts.

Many have reported their double glazing to be sliding or dropping. This can be due to many factors, such as extreme weather conditions or damage from falling objects. It is worth contacting the window manufacturer as soon as you notice an issue, and remember to follow up in writing.

Hardware

Double-glazed windows can face several issues over time. Some of these issues include leaks, water intrusion and foggy windows. While many people think that they need to replace their entire window when these issues arise but the reality is that the majority can be fixed without the need for a new installation.

The first step to fix a double-glazed window is to remove the old pane. This should be done with care to avoid further damage to the glass. After that, you should take off any sealants or paint around the edges of your glass. This can be accomplished using either a putty knife, or a scraper. Once the old pane is removed, the new one can be placed in the frame and a fresh layer of sealant applied.

If the window is covered by warranty, you might be able to request that the manufacturer replace the glass unit at no charge. If not, you should employ a professional to examine and repair the window.

While glass is a crucial component of a double-glazed upvc window repairs but the hardware is crucial for ensuring that it works effectively. This includes the sash as well as balance that are used to open and close the window. If these components are damaged, it may be difficult to operate the window and could cause safety hazards. If the sash or balance are damaged, it's best to contact a double glazing expert for repair services.

Another common issue with double glazed windows is condensation that forms between the panes. This is caused by warm air coming into contact with the cooler panes of windows. While this is a natural process but it can also lead to water infiltration and the rotting process. To prevent this from happening, it is important to install a suitable ventilation system within your home.

If you own a property that is listed it is essential to choose a double glazing firm that has worked with historic properties. In many instances, it is possible for listed buildings to be fitted with double-glazed units that are slim profile without compromising their style. These options can be designed to look similar to the original windows and will keep your home warm without compromising the historic appeal.
